javascript

[28/47]

  1. JavaScript で要素にクラスを追加する - その他の方法
    JavaScript で DOM 操作を行う際、要素にクラスを追加することは一般的な操作です。主に次の 2 つの方法があります。この方法は最も一般的で推奨される方法です。document. getElementById('myElement') で ID が 'myElement' の要素を取得します。
  2. JavaScriptにおけるHTTP GETリクエストの代替方法
    HTTP GETリクエストは、サーバーからデータを取得するための基本的な方法です。JavaScriptでは、XMLHttpRequestオブジェクトやFetch APIを使用して、HTTP GETリクエストを送信することができます。new XMLHttpRequest() で新しいリクエストオブジェクトを作成します。 open() メソッドでリクエストメソッド(GET)、URL、非同期かどうか(true)を指定します。 onload イベントハンドラでレスポンス処理を行います。 send() メソッドでリクエストを送信します。
  3. jQueryでチェックボックスの状態を確認するコード例の詳細解説
    JavaScriptのライブラリであるjQueryを使って、HTMLのチェックボックスがチェックされているかどうかを確認する方法を説明します。(document).ready(function()):∗∗ドキュメントが完全に読み込まれた後に実行される関数を定義します。2.∗∗("#myCheckbox"): IDが"myCheckbox"の要素(チェックボックス)を取得します。
  4. JavaScript 二次元配列の作成: その他の方法
    JavaScript には厳密な二次元配列のデータ型はありませんが、配列の配列として表現することができます。つまり、各要素が配列であるような一次元配列を作成します。最もシンプルな方法です。より動的な配列を作成する場合に便利です。配列を作成する便利な方法です。
  5. JavaScript オブジェクトのループ処理:より高度な手法と注意点
    JavaScript では、オブジェクトの要素をループ処理するためにいくつかの方法があります。主に for. ..in ループと、オブジェクトのメソッドである Object. keys()、Object. values()、Object. entries() を組み合わせた方法が使用されます。
  6. JavaScriptにおけるオブジェクトに対するmap関数
    JavaScriptにおいて、配列(Array)は順序付けられたデータの集合であり、各要素にインデックスでアクセスできます。一方、オブジェクト(Object)はキーと値のペアの集合で、キーは文字列またはシンボルであり、値は任意のデータ型です。
  7. HTML テキスト入力フィールドに数値のみ入力可能にする (JavaScript, jQuery, HTML)
    HTML のテキスト入力フィールドに数値のみ入力できるようにする方法について、JavaScript、jQuery、HTML を使用して説明します。最も簡単な方法は、HTML の <input> 要素の type 属性を number に設定することです。これにより、ブラウザは自動的に数値入力フィールドとして扱います。
  8. JavaScriptでURLパラメータを取得するコード例の詳細解説
    JavaScriptにおいて、URLに付与されたパラメータ(GETパラメータ)を取得する方法について説明します。URLパラメータとは、URLの疑問符(?)以降に付与されるキーと値のペアのことを指します。例えば、 というURLの場合、"q"と"page"がキー、"javascript"と"2"が値になります。
  9. Node.jsの完全アンインストールと再インストールの代替方法
    JavaScript、Node. js、npmに関するプログラミングにおいて、問題が発生した場合や、環境を完全にリセットしたい場合は、Node. jsを完全にアンインストールして再インストールすることが必要になる場合があります。アンインストール手順
  10. JavaScriptでの数値の通貨フォーマットのコード解説
    JavaScript では、数値を通貨形式の文字列に変換する方法はいくつかあります。最も一般的な方法は、toLocaleString() メソッドと Intl. NumberFormat() オブジェクトを使用することです。このメソッドは、ロケール固有の形式で数値を文字列に変換します。通貨形式を使用するには、オプションとして style: 'currency' を指定します。
  11. JavaScript での文字列チェックのコード例
    JavaScript では、変数のデータ型を確認するために typeof 演算子を使用します。文字列かどうかチェックするには、次のようにします:このコードでは、変数名 の値が文字列かどうかチェックしています。もし文字列であれば、"変数は文字列です" と出力されます。そうでなければ、"変数は文字列ではありません" と出力されます。
  12. JavaScriptにおけるオブジェクトのディープコピーの効率的な方法
    ディープコピーとは、オブジェクトの完全な独立したコピーを作成することです。元のオブジェクトとコピーされたオブジェクトは、互いに影響を与えません。オブジェクトの構造を保持しながら、元のデータを変更せずに操作したい場合。オブジェクトを関数に渡す際、元のオブジェクトを変更したくない場合。
  13. JavaScript でランダムな文字列を生成するコード解説
    JavaScript では、ランダムな文字列や文字を生成するさまざまな方法があります。一般的な手法は、Math. random() 関数を利用して乱数を生成し、それを文字に変換することです。また、より安全性の高い乱数が必要な場合は、crypto
  14. JavaScriptで配列の合計を求める方法の解説
    JavaScriptやjQueryでは、配列内の数値の合計を求める方法はいくつかあります。最も一般的な方法は、ループを使って各要素を足し合わせる方法です。しかし、より簡潔で効率的な方法として、reduce()メソッドを使うこともできます。jQueryはDOM操作のためのライブラリであり、配列の操作を直接行う機能はありません。しかし、jQueryで取得した要素の値を配列に変換し、その後JavaScriptの方法を使って合計を求めることができます。
  15. JavaScriptでクリップボードにコピーする代替方法とその解説
    JavaScriptでテキストをクリップボードにコピーするには、主に2つの方法があります。Async Clipboard API (navigator. clipboard. writeText) 新しい方法で、推奨されます。 非同期処理のため、Promise を使用します。
  16. JavaScript オブジェクトの長さを取得する代替的な方法
    JavaScriptにおけるオブジェクトは、プロパティとメソッドを持つデータ構造です。プロパティはデータの値を保持し、メソッドはオブジェクトに対して実行できる関数です。JavaScriptの標準的なオブジェクトには、一般的に「長さ」という概念はありません。これは、配列のようなインデックスベースのデータ構造ではないためです。
  17. JavaScript で日付を yyyy-mm-dd 形式にフォーマットするコード解説
    JavaScript で日付オブジェクトを取得し、それを "yyyy-mm-dd" の形式の文字列に変換する方法について説明します。formatDateAsYYYYMMDD関数: 引数として日付オブジェクトを受け取り、yyyy-mm-dd形式の文字列を返す関数です。
  18. JavaScriptにおけるnull, undefined, 空文字のチェックの代替方法
    JavaScriptにおいて、変数がnull、undefined、または空文字であるかを判定する標準的な関数はあるのでしょうか?JavaScriptには、null, undefined, または空文字を直接チェックする組み込みの関数はありません。
  19. JavaScript で文字列を日付オブジェクトに変換する
    JavaScript では、文字列形式の日付データを Date オブジェクトに変換することで、日付に関する様々な操作が可能になります。この変換プロセスを「日付パース」と呼びます。日付オブジェクトを作成するには、new Date() コンストラクタを使用します。
  20. JavaScript での GUID/UUID 生成コード解説
    GUID (Globally Unique Identifier) と UUID (Universally Unique Identifier) は、重複しない一意な識別子を生成する仕組みです。ソフトウェア開発において、データレコードを一意に識別するために広く使用されます。
  21. Uncaught ReferenceError: $ が定義されていません のコード例と jQuery エラー解決ガイド
    このエラーは、JavaScript プログラミングにおいて、jQuery ライブラリを使用しようとした際に発生します。何が起こっているのか?jQuery ライブラリがロードされていないか、正しくロードされていません。コード内で $ 記号を使って jQuery の機能を使おうとしていますが、jQuery が利用できない状態です。
  22. JavaScript, jQuery でページをリフレッシュする方法
    JavaScript でページをリフレッシュする最も一般的な方法は、location. reload() メソッドを使用することです。location. reload() は、現在のページを再読み込みします。location. reload(true) は、キャッシュを無視して強制的に再読み込みします。
  23. JavaScript, jQuery, および配列における重複値の削除
    JavaScript や jQuery で配列から重複する値を削除する方法について説明します。JavaScript の Set オブジェクトは重複を許容しないため、重複値を除去するのに便利です。配列をフィルタリングし、各要素のインデックスと最後に現れるインデックスが一致するものを残します。
  24. jQueryを使ったスムーズスクロールのコード解説
    jQueryは、JavaScriptライブラリの一つで、DOM操作やアニメーションなどを簡潔に記述できるようになります。その機能の一つとして、ページ内の特定の要素までスムーズにスクロールさせることができます。$('html, body'): HTML要素とbody要素全体を選択しています。
  25. jQuery で要素が隠れているか確認するコード例の詳細解説
    JavaScript、jQuery、DOM に関連して、jQuery で要素が隠れているかどうかをチェックする方法を説明します。jQuery の :hidden セレクターを使用するjQuery では、:hidden セレクターを使用して要素が隠れているかどうか簡単にチェックできます。
  26. JavaScript オブジェクトのプロパティ削除に関するコード例解説
    JavaScript のオブジェクトからプロパティを削除するには、主に delete 演算子を使用します。delete person. age; の部分は、オブジェクト person のプロパティ age を削除しています。削除が成功すると、true が返されます。失敗すると、false が返されます。
  27. JavaScript オブジェクト配列の文字列プロパティによるソート:コード例解説
    JavaScriptにおいて、オブジェクトの配列を特定の文字列プロパティの値に基づいてソートする方法について説明します。オブジェクト配列の例:sort() メソッドと比較関数:JavaScriptでは、配列の sort() メソッドを使用して要素を並び替えることができます。文字列プロパティに基づいてソートするには、比較関数を引数として渡します。
  28. JavaScript 配列の最後の要素を取得する (ES2022)
    JavaScript の配列から最後の要素を取得する方法について説明します。ES2022 で導入された at() メソッドが最も簡潔で安全な方法です。ES2022 で導入された at() メソッドは、配列の任意のインデックスの要素を取得するのに便利です。負のインデックスを指定すると、配列の末尾から数えた位置の要素を取得できます。
  29. JavaScript で日付を比較するコード解説
    JavaScript では、日付を比較するためにいくつかの方法があります。主に、Date オブジェクトを利用し、比較演算子や getTime() メソッドを使用します。JavaScript で日付を扱うには、Date オブジェクトを使います。これは、日付と時刻を表すための組み込みオブジェクトです。
  30. JavaScript で文字列をブール値に変換する例を詳しく解説します
    JavaScript では、文字列をブール値に変換するいくつかの方法があります。どの方法を使うかは、変換したい文字列の内容や、期待する結果によって異なります。Boolean コンストラクタは、引数として渡された値をブール値に変換します。二重否定演算子を使うと、簡潔にブール値に変換できます。
  31. JavaScript, jQuery での変数の「未定義」または「null」のチェック
    JavaScript や jQuery では、変数が「未定義」または「null」であるかどうかをチェックすることが重要です。これらは異なる概念ですが、多くの場合、一緒に扱われます。未定義 (undefined): 変数が宣言されているが、まだ値が割り当てられていない状態です。
  32. JavaScript配列の重複値除去: 固有値を取得する
    JavaScriptにおいて、配列から重複する要素を除去し、固有の値のみを取得する方法について説明します。固有値とは、配列内で重複しない値のことを指します。一般的に、以下の手法が使用されます:Setオブジェクトは、重複しない値の集合を表します。
  33. JavaScriptで要素のクラスを変更する - その他の方法
    JavaScriptでは、HTML要素のクラス属性を変更することができます。これにより、要素のスタイルや動作を動的に変更することができます。主に以下の方法があります。最も直接的な方法です。要素のclassNameプロパティに新しいクラス名を設定します。
  34. JavaScriptにおける配列への要素挿入の代替方法
    JavaScriptにおいて、配列の特定の位置に要素を挿入するには、主に splice() メソッドが使用されます。このメソッドは、配列から要素を削除したり、新しい要素を追加したりすることができます。開始位置: 挿入を開始するインデックスです。
  35. ChromeにおけるSame Origin Policyの代替手法
    Same Origin Policy (SOP) とは、セキュリティ上の理由から、異なるドメイン間のスクリプトが相互にアクセスできないようにするブラウザのセキュリティ制限です。 JavaScript、Ajaxといった技術を用いたWebアプリケーション開発において、この制限はしばしば障害となります。 Chromeでは、開発目的でこのSOPを一時的に無効化する方法があります。
  36. JavaScriptで配列に特定の値が含まれるかチェックする方法
    JavaScriptでは、配列に特定の値が含まれているかどうかを調べるために、主に次の2つの方法が使用されます。includes()メソッド: 配列に指定した値が含まれている場合にtrueを、含まれていない場合にfalseを返します。indexOf()メソッド: 配列内で指定した値が見つかった場合にそのインデックスを、見つからなかった場合に-1を返します。
  37. JavaScript オブジェクトにおけるキーの存在確認のコード解説
    JavaScript では、オブジェクトはキーと値のペアで構成されるデータ構造です。あるキーが存在するか否かをチェックする方法はいくつかあります。最もシンプルな方法です。オブジェクト内に指定したキーが存在する場合、true を返します。オブジェクト自身が持つプロパティかどうかをチェックします。プロトタイプチェーン上のプロパティは含まれません。
  38. JavaScriptで「undefined」をチェックするコード例
    JavaScriptにおいて、「undefined」は変数が宣言されているが値が割り当てられていない場合の値です。この状態をチェックする方法は主に2つあります。typeof演算子は変数のデータ型を文字列で返します。もし変数が「undefined」であれば、typeof演算子は"undefined"を返します。
  39. 新しいタブを開くJavaScript (New Tab in JavaScript)
    JavaScriptで新しいタブを開くには、主に2つの方法があります。target="_blank"属性をaタグに追加します。この方法が最も一般的で推奨されます。第二引数に'_blank'を指定します。この方法は、動的にURLを生成する場合などに使用できますが、ポップアップブロッカーの影響を受けやすいため注意が必要です。
  40. JavaScriptで現在のURLを取得する代替方法
    JavaScriptで現在のページのURLを取得するには、window. locationオブジェクトを使用します。このオブジェクトには、現在のページのURLに関する様々な情報が含まれています。window. location. href: 現在のページの完全なURLを取得します。
  41. jQueryでチェックボックスを操作するコード例の詳細解説
    jQueryを使ってチェックボックスをチェック状態にするには、.prop()メソッドを使用します。このメソッドは要素のプロパティを操作するためのものです。(function()...);∗∗:ドキュメントが完全に読み込まれた後に実行されるコードをラップします。2.∗∗("#myCheckbox"):IDが "myCheckbox" の要素を選択し、jQueryオブジェクトとして返します。
  42. CORSエラーと解決方法のコード例
    このエラーは、JavaScriptのFetch APIを使って異なるドメインのREST APIからデータを取得しようとした際に発生します。これは、ブラウザのセキュリティポリシーである「Same-Origin Policy」によるものです。このポリシーは、異なるドメイン間のスクリプト同士の相互作用を制限し、セキュリティを確保しています。
  43. JavaScriptでテキスト入力値を取得する:代替方法と詳細解説
    JavaScriptでは、テキスト入力フィールドの値を取得するために、value プロパティを使用します。このプロパティは、ユーザーが入力したテキストの内容を返します。要素の取得: document. getElementById("myInput") は、IDが "myInput" の要素を取得します。この場合、テキスト入力フィールドです。
  44. JavaScript オブジェクトへのキーと値のペアの追加:コード例解説
    JavaScript のオブジェクトリテラルは、キーと値のペアの集合を表します。新しいキーと値のペアを追加するには、主に次の2つの方法があります。オブジェクト名に続けてドットとキー名を指定します。オブジェクト名に続けてブラケットで囲まれたキー名を指定します。この方法では、動的なキー名を使用できます。
  45. JavaScriptで文字列の最初の文字を大文字にする方法のコード解説
    JavaScriptで文字列の最初の文字を大文字にするには、いくつかの方法があります。方法1: slice()とtoUpperCase()を使うstr. charAt(0): 文字列の最初の文字を取得します。toUpperCase(): 文字を大文字に変換します。
  46. ES6 の import ステートメントとエラー「Uncaught SyntaxError: Cannot use import statement outside a module」
    このエラーは、JavaScript の ECMAScript 6(ES6)で導入された import ステートメントを、モジュールではない環境で使用しようとしたときに発生します。モジュールとは モジュールは、コードを再利用可能な単位に分割する仕組みです。ES6 以降、JavaScript ではモジュールを正式にサポートするようになりました。モジュールは、他のモジュールからコードをインポートし、エクスポートすることができます。
  47. JavaScriptで配列を空にする:その他の方法と注意点
    JavaScriptでは、配列を空にする方法は主に3つあります。最も一般的な方法です。配列の length プロパティを0に設定することで、すべての要素が削除されます。既存の配列を新しい空の配列で置き換えます。配列のすべての要素を削除することもできます。
  48. JavaScriptの空オブジェクト判定のコード例解説
    JavaScriptにおいて、オブジェクトが空かどうかを判定する方法はいくつかあります。以下に主要な方法を説明します。Object. keysメソッドを使用するこの方法では、オブジェクトのプロパティ名を配列として取得し、その配列の長さが0かどうかをチェックします。
  49. JavaScript で現在の日付を取得するコード解説
    JavaScript で現在の時刻を取得するには、Date オブジェクトを使用します。このオブジェクトには、年、月、日、時間、分、秒などの日付関連の情報を保持しています。上記のコードは、現在の時刻を表す Date オブジェクトを作成し、currentDate 変数に代入します。
  50. JavaScriptのタイムスタンプ取得に関するコード例解説
    JavaScriptでタイムスタンプを取得するには、主に次の方法があります。Date. now(): ミリ秒単位の現在のタイムスタンプを取得します。これらの方法はすべて同じ結果を返しますが、書き方の違いがあります。静的なメソッドなので、直接 Date